Funding retirement: Retirement Interest Only mortgages A large number of Australians do not have enough money saved to fund a comfortable retirement. According to the Association of Superannuation Funds of Australia (ASFA), Australians need 70% of their annual pre-retirement income during retirement – with the average Australian falling 40% below this benchmark.
